From: Inhibition of microRNA-15 protects H9c2 cells against CVB3-induced myocardial injury by targeting NLRX1 to regulate the NLRP3 inflammasome

Fig. 1

Inhibition of miR-15 alleviated myocardial cell injury induced by coxsackievirus B3 (CVB3). H9c2 cells were transfected with miR-15 inhibitor or inhibitor-NC for 24 h, and then infected with CVB3 for another 24 h. a – Expression of miR-15 was determined using quantitative real-time PCR and normalized to U6 expression. b through d – Lactate dehydrogenase (b), creatine kinase-MB (c), and cTn-I (d) levels in the supernatants of cell lysates were determined using a fully automatic biochemical analyzer. *p < 0.05 versus the control group, #p < 0.05 versus the CVB3 group
